Learn how to solve definition of derivative problems step by step online. Find the derivative of 16*20 using the definition. Multiply 16 times 20. Find the derivative of 320 using the definition. Apply the definition of the derivative: \displaystyle f'(x)=\lim_{h\to0}\frac{f(x+h)-f(x)}{h}. The function f(x) is the function we want to differentiate, which is 320. Substituting f(x+h) and f(x) on the limit, we get. Subtract the values 320 and -320. Zero divided by anything is equal to zero.
